Episode 024 Celebrating Advent

November 22, 2016 11:00 - 40 minutes - 37.4 MB

Advent is a period of spiritual preparation for the coming of Jesus Christ at Christmas. Advent begins on the fourth Sunday prior to Christmas Day and lasts through Christmas Eve, or December 24. It’s a great way to keep Christ at the center of the season. There are so many different variations and interpretations of Advent customs that exist today.
